BRITISH COLUMBIA UTiliTIES COMMISSfON ORDER 2 NUMBER COM-2-82 NOW THEREFORE the Commission hereby orders as follows: 1. If existing producers in the Pool and the B.C.P.C. are unable to agree on a satisfactory method of reducing the gas volume purchase obligation of each existing contract in the Pool, the obligation of B.C.P.C. to purchase gas from each contract providing for delivery of gas from the Pool shall be reduced. The reduction shall apply to each contract in force at that time and shall be a percentage of the maximum volume of gas which B.C.P.C. is obliged at the time of reduction to purchase each day or each year (whichever is specified in the contract) applicable to lands within the Pool. The percentage shall be the same as the percentage which the maximum daily delivery obligation for the new well is of the total maximum daily delivery obligation of all producers from the Pool. The date for all reductions to contract volumes shall be the same date Westgrowth is entitled to resume production from the Pool.
